Lifts at Fennwick Court are serviced every Saturday, 07:00–12:00. During that window, use stairwell B only. Stairwell doors auto-lock on weekends. Assistants escorting anyone with mobility needs should pre-book the goods lift via the facilities line by Friday noon. Weekend stairwell access requires the door code below.

turnstile pass: bdg-TXR-4

Quarterly Planning Note — Divestiture of the Coastal Tooling Unit

For the finance team: the sale of the Coastal Tooling unit to Pellmark Industries remains on track for close in Q3. Please finalize the carve-out balance sheet, reconcile intercompany positions, and prepare the working-capital adjustment schedule by month-end. Audit support requests should be prioritized. For planning purposes, note the following sensitive item:

internal memo for hawef-kahif: The finance team signed off on a budget of $25.9 million for Project Sorox. The renewal with Pelokek Logistics closes at $51.7 million a year, 52 percent below the last contract.

## 2.4.0

Renamed `KV_BLOOM_SIZE` to `HUSKVAULT_BLOOM_BITS`. The old name implied entries; the value is bits. Migration: multiply your previous entry count by 10 and set the new key. Old key is rejected at startup with a hard error, not ignored — this is intentional after the Pellworth incident where a silent fallback shrank the filter and hammered the store with misses. False-positive target stays at 1%. The filter snapshot uploader still needs its store credential, set on the following line.

secret setting of yafof-tawep: RELAY_SECRET8=8abb5772

When reviewing changes to the Calcwright formula sandbox, verify that user-supplied expressions never escape the interpreter's allowlist. Every builtin must be explicitly registered; reflection and I/O primitives stay disabled. Pay particular attention to timeout and memory caps, since those are the last line of defense. The sandbox enforces the limits configured below.

settings of tagef-bawif:
DRUIX_HOST=druix.zemvarlabs.internal
DRUIX_PORT=8000